Ryan Griffiths (NCF) shared Grant information. ryan@ncf.uk.com Cecil Pettit was one of the founding members of Ability Northants, a charity dedicated to enriching the lives of people living with disabilities. Following his passing in 2000,?a legacy fund was established to carry on Cecil Pettit's?good work.?This fund is?managed and facilitated by Northamptonshire Community Foundation, with the aim to fund?projects supporting?people living with disabilities.? Examples of some of the?types of projects this fund could support include: o Support or advocacy groups? o Helping people living with disabilities by providing accessible educational or training activities? o Health and well-being projects to reduce social isolation The maximum funding award is £3,000. In order to apply please complete an?expression of interest form?by Friday 24th February 2023 and email to Ryan Griffiths:?ryan@ncf.uk.com Carl raised about costings for use of pools and how expensive it is for groups to hire various centres etc. Nick Wilson shared VR Therapies as a contact. Ryan Griffiths confirmed that groups could apply for funding but would need to be a constituted group.
